Bizen ware

Bizen ware is a traditional Japanese pottery known for its rustic, natural appearance and unglazed, earthy surface. Made in Okayama Prefecture, it is crafted through a centuries-old, high-temperature wood-firing process that creates unique textures and organic patterns, often with ash deposits and natural flaws. The pottery is prized for its durability and ability to enhance the flavors of tea and food, making it popular for tea ceremonies and everyday use. Each piece is handcrafted, ensuring that no two are exactly alike, reflecting the natural beauty and craftsmanship of the Bizen tradition.
